The Rise of Wafer Recessed Lighting
Wafer recessed lighting, also known as slim or low-profile recessed lighting, has gained traction due to its versatility and aesthetic appeal. Unlike traditional recessed lights, which often require extensive housing and installation space, wafer lights are designed to fit into tight spaces, making them ideal for areas with limited ceiling height. This innovation has transformed how designers and homeowners approach lighting, allowing for more creative and functional uses of space.
Benefits of Wafer Recessed Lighting
One of the primary advantages of wafer recessed lighting is its energy efficiency. Many models utilize LED technology, which consumes significantly less energy than incandescent or fluorescent options. This not only reduces electricity bills for homeowners but also contributes to a greener environment. Furthermore, the longevity of LED bulbs means less frequent replacements, which can save both time and money in the long run.
Additionally, wafer lights offer a sleek, unobtrusive look that can seamlessly blend into any décor. Their low profile allows for creative lighting designs, enhancing the overall ambiance of a space without drawing attention to the fixtures themselves. The ability to choose from various color temperatures also allows homeowners to customize the mood of a room, whether they prefer a warm, inviting glow or a cool, energizing light.

Challenges in Installation
Despite the many benefits, lighting contractors often encounter challenges when installing wafer recessed lighting. Understanding these potential pitfalls can help avoid costly mistakes and ensure a smooth installation process.
Insufficient Space Considerations
One of the most common issues in wafer recessed lighting installation is inadequate space. While these lights are designed for low-profile applications, contractors must still account for the depth of the ceiling and any obstructions such as ductwork, plumbing, or electrical wiring. Failing to do so can lead to installation delays and additional costs.
Before beginning an installation, it is essential to conduct a thorough site assessment. This includes measuring the ceiling space, identifying potential obstacles, and ensuring that the chosen fixtures can be accommodated without compromising safety or functionality. Additionally, it is wise to consider the type of ceiling material being used, as some materials may require special handling or additional support to securely hold the recessed lights in place. For example, drywall ceilings may need reinforcement around the cutouts to prevent sagging over time, while ceilings made of concrete or plaster may require specialized tools for precise cutting and installation.
Electrical Compatibility
Another critical aspect to consider is the electrical compatibility of wafer recessed lights. Not all fixtures are designed to work with existing electrical systems, and mismatches can lead to flickering lights or complete failures. Contractors should verify that the voltage and wattage requirements of the chosen fixtures align with the home’s electrical infrastructure.
Moreover, it is advisable to check for any specific installation requirements outlined by the manufacturer. Some wafer lights may require specific dimmer switches or transformers, which can impact the overall performance of the lighting system. In addition, contractors should be aware of the potential need for circuit upgrades if the existing wiring cannot support the new fixtures. This might involve consulting with an electrician to assess the load capacity and ensure that the entire lighting system operates efficiently and safely. Understanding these electrical nuances not only enhances the performance of the lighting but also contributes to the longevity of the installation, reducing the likelihood of future repairs or replacements.
Best Practices for Installation
To ensure a successful installation of wafer recessed lighting, contractors should adhere to best practices that promote efficiency and quality. These practices not only enhance the installation process but also contribute to long-term client satisfaction.
Planning and Design
Effective planning is the cornerstone of any successful lighting installation. Before starting, contractors should collaborate with clients to understand their lighting needs and preferences. This includes discussing the desired ambiance, functionality, and any specific design elements that should be incorporated.
Creating a lighting plan that outlines the placement of each fixture can help visualize the final outcome. This plan should consider factors such as the height of the ceiling, the purpose of each room, and the overall aesthetic of the space. By taking the time to design a thoughtful layout, contractors can avoid common mistakes and ensure a cohesive look.
Utilizing Quality Materials
Investing in high-quality materials is essential for a successful installation. While it may be tempting to cut costs by opting for cheaper fixtures, this can lead to long-term issues such as reduced energy efficiency, frequent replacements, and dissatisfied clients. Choosing reputable brands and products that come with warranties can provide peace of mind and enhance the overall quality of the installation.
Additionally, using quality wiring and connectors is crucial for ensuring the safety and reliability of the lighting system. Poor-quality materials can lead to electrical hazards and malfunctioning fixtures, ultimately compromising the integrity of the installation.
